How Semax Works — Mechanisms & Research
BDNF (Brain-Derived Neurotrophic Factor) is a central target in cognitive research, and several neuropeptides show evidence of influencing its expression or downstream signaling. Semax has been studied in models of cognitive enhancement, stress response modulation, and neuroprotection. The mechanisms vary by compound: Semax appears to work through direct BDNF upregulation; Dihexa (N-hexanoic-Tyr-Ile-(6) aminohexanoic amide) has been shown in animal models to act as a hepatocyte growth factor (HGF) mimetic that promotes MET receptor activation — a pathway linked to synaptogenesis. Understanding the specific mechanism of Semax is essential for designing experiments that test the right outcomes with the right models in Recursolândia research contexts.
Sourcing Research-Grade Semax
Assessing Semax vendors begins with the COA: access the batch-specific certificate before purchasing, not after. Mass spectrometry in the COA establishes that the main HPLC peak is actually Semax and not a structurally similar impurity — HPLC purity alone provides no identity confirmation. Red flags in Semax vendor evaluation: prices far under typical market pricing, unclear production details, no community presence, and COAs that lack endotoxin data. The lyophilised (freeze-dried) form of Semax is far superior to liquid pre-made solutions — lyophilised powder maintains stability for years when frozen, while liquid preparations lose activity within weeks.

What is Semax?
Semax is a synthetic heptapeptide (MEHFPGP) derived from the ACTH4-7 fragment (Met-Glu-His-Phe) with a Pro-Gly-Pro C-terminal extension for stability. It has been studied for nootropic effects, BDNF upregulation, and neuroprotection in animal models. It has been used clinically in Russia for cognitive and neurological applications.
How is Semax administered in research?
The most studied administration route for Semax in both animal models and human research is intranasal. Intranasal delivery bypasses the blood-brain barrier via olfactory nerve transport. Subcutaneous injection is also used in animal studies. Intranasal Semax requires a specialized intranasal delivery device or dropper.
What purity should research Semax be?
Research-grade Semax should be ≥98% pure by HPLC. The COA should confirm the molecular weight of 887.0 Da by mass spectrometry. Due to the nasal mucosa sensitivity of the intranasal route, a low endotoxin level is particularly important to verify.
How should Semax be stored?
Lyophilized Semax should be stored at −20°C. Once reconstituted or in liquid form, it should be kept refrigerated at 2-8°C and used within the vendor's specified timeframe (typically 4 weeks). Some researchers freeze Semax solution in individual use-aliquots to minimize repeated refrigeration exposure.
What does BDNF have to do with Semax?
BDNF (Brain-Derived Neurotrophic Factor) is a key regulator of neuroplasticity, neuronal survival, and synaptic strengthening. Animal model studies have documented that Semax administration upregulates BDNF expression in brain regions relevant to cognition and stress response. This BDNF upregulation is considered a primary mechanistic hypothesis for Semax's nootropic effects.
